Stefano Perrone: From Art Director to Painter of Vectors and Absence
Born in 1985, Stefano Perrone is a painter based in Monza, Italy. He graduated with a degree in Industrial Design from Politecnico di Milano in 2008 and initially worked as an art director for Saatchi & Saatchi and McCann Erickson before dedicating himself to painting in 2015. In July 2019, he participated in a residency at L21 gallery in Mallorca. His solo exhibitions feature 'In conversation with Przemek Pyszczek' (2020), 'Maschere in Villa' (2018), 'Beneath and Beyond' (2017), 'VOID' (2017), and 'Vertigo' (2016), while group exhibitions include 'Turn on the bright lights' (2020) and 'Transatlantico' (2020). Perrone’s artwork, noted for its vectorial lines, delves into themes of movement and absence, drawing inspiration from Renaissance artists. His piece 'Camice su camicia' (2020) foreshadowed the significance of medical coats during the COVID-19 pandemic.

- His painting 'Camice su camicia' (2020) was based on an Instagram advertisement and foreshadowed the COVID-19 pandemic.
- Perrone uses vectorial lines in his paintings, a technique derived from his graphic design background.
- He prefers oil on panel and small formats for their intimacy.
